MUMBAI, India, Nov. 14 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202411025532 A) filed by Chandigarh Group Of Colleges, Mohali, Punjab, on March 28, 2024, for 'adaptable lens covering assistive device.'
Inventor(s) include Mandeep Kaur; Dr. Shweta Lamba; Dr. Ranjan Sariyal; Aryan; and Sahib.
The application for the patent was published on Nov. 14, under issue no. 46/2025.
According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"An adaptable lens covering assistive device, comprising a cylindrical frame 1 positioned in proximity to a lens of a camera, an imaging unit 2 integrated in the frame 1 to determine dimensions of lens, a pulley arrangement 3 integrated with the frame 1 for allowing accommodation of the frame 1 on lens properly, an inflatable member 5 integrated on a pair of rods 4 arranged on the frame 1 to get inflated for adhering to upper and lower portions of the lens for securing the frame 1 on the lens, a clamp 7 integrated on the frame 1 by means of a robotic link 6 to hold the camera for securing the frame 1 on camera, a microphone integrated on the frame 1 for receiving frame 1 removing command, a hinge joint 8 arranged with the link 6 for orienting the frame 1 away from lens to free the lens."
